Seduction of the Innocent {Three-Dimensional} 3-D Comics Lot
Includes 3D Glasses that were not the original issue. (see 20th scan)
This two-issue 3-D series from Eclipse Comics reprints/collects stories from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series). It’s an anthology of three-dimensional horror presented by various writers and artists with legendary Ray Zone handling the 3-D Process. And features cover art by legends; Dave Stevens on issue #1 & Berni Wrightson on issue #2. Awesome!!
Seduction of the Innocent {Three-Dimensional} Comics Lot Includes:
Seduction of the Innocent {Three-Dimensional} #1 (October 1985)
Editors: Catherine Yronwode & Dean Mullaney
Cover by: Dave Stevens
“Don’t Reap a… Harvest of Death” 1 page
Artist: George Roussos
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
We dare you to take these Adventures into Darkness.
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“The Evil Ones” 1 page
Writer: ?
Artist: Mike Sekowsky
Inker: Mike Peppe
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
There have always been certain people set apart as the “Evil Ones” who possess power to injure or destroy their neighbors…
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“Death Dives Deep” 4 pages
Writer: Gene Fawcette
Artist: Gene Fawcette
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
Undersea treachery ensues when treasure hunters discover a treasure but greed leads to murder.
Reprints Crypt of Horror (AC, 2005 series) #5 (2008)
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“Harvest of Death” 7 pages
Writer: ?
Artist: Mort Meskin
Inker: George Roussos
Colorist: Tony Alderson (3-D Process)
A macabre legend that a vineyard can only produce if it is fertilized with human blood leads the owner to murder.
Reprints Crypt of Horror (AC, 2005 series) #25 (2015)
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“Do You Believe…” 0.5 page
Writer: Gene Fawcette
Artist: Gene Fawcette
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
Similar to Ripley’s Believe It or Not!… featuring supernatural tales.
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“The Velvet Vampire” 0.5 page
Writer: Gene Fawcette
Artist: Gene Fawcette
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
A tale of a young female vampire.
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“That Stray Cat” 6 pages
Writer: ?
Artist: Mike Roy
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
A man’s hatred of cats causes him to kill, but a mysterious stray cat has the last meow.
Reprints Crypt of Horror (AC, 2005 series) #25 (2015) [2 pp. only]
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“Blood Will Tell” 2 pages
Writer: Serge Desmodus
Artist: Serge Desmodus
Colorist: ? (3-D Process)
A text story of a vampire.
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“Gift Of Murder” 2 pages
Writer: ?
Artist: Alex Toth
Inker: Mike Peppe
Colorist: Tony Alderson (3-D Process)
A husband misjudges his wife and murders her.
Reprints The Alex Toth Reader (Pure Imagination, 1995 series)
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#15
“Charms” 1 page
Writer: ?
Artist: Mike Sekowsky
Inker: Mike Peppe
Colorist: ? (3-D Process)
Similar to Ripley’s Believe It or Not!… featuring supernatural tales of “good luck” charms.
Originally intended for Adventures into Darkness #15 (Pines, 1952 series); 3- D effects by Tony Alderson
“Tryst With Terror” 7 pages
Writer: ?
Artist: Mort Meskin
Inker: George Roussos
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
An inventor creates a female robot to kill his rivals for his true love, but the female robot will not be a woman scorned.
Seduction of the Innocent {Three-Dimensional} #2 (April 1986)
Editor: Dean Mullaney
Cover by: Berni Wrightson
“Was He Death-Proof?” 6 pages
Writer: ?
Artists: Matt Baker & Alex Blum
Inker: David Heames
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
A condemned murder vow to return after a death sentence and seek revenge.
Reprints Journey into Fear (Superior, 1951 series) #1 (May 1951)
“More Deadly Than The Male” 6 pages
Writer: ?
Artist: Vince Fodera
Colorists: Ray Zone & John Rupkaivis (3-D Process)
On an alien planet, astronauts encounter a mysterious female population where there are no males.
Reprints Weird Mysteries (Stanley Morse, 1952 series) #7 (October 1953)
“Trophies of Doom” 6 pages
Writer: ?
Artist: Nick Cardy
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
Similar to Edgar Allan Poe’s The Tell-Tale Heart. An executioner is haunted by the people he beheaded after he himself commits murder.
Reprints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#11 (September 1953)
“The Monster In The Maze” 4 pages
Writer: ?
Artist: Ross Andru
Inker: Mike Esposito
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
Howard and Amy visit the Minoan palace on Crete. They discover the legendary labyrinth and encounter the monstrous Minotaur. Howard escapes with his life only to be locked up in an insane asylum.
Reprints Adventures into Darkness (Pines, 1952 series) #13 (March 1954)
“The Man Who Was Always On Time!” 5 pages
Writer: ?
Artist: Alex Toth
Inker: Mike Peppe
Colorist: Ray Zone (3-D Process)
A wealthy man who is a fanatic for clocks tries to steal a priceless clock and finds that his time has run out.
Reprints Out of the Shadows (Pines, 1952 series) #12 (March 1954)
